Lithology and environment
Primary lithology: | conglomerate |
Secondary lithology: | silty claystone |
Includes fossils? | Y |
Lithology description: fluvial conglomerates, towards the top they show marine influence, and conglomerates are overlain by silty clays, travertinous limestones and gypsum. | |
Environment: | marginal marine indet. |
